Warum schlägt ccmexec meine Festplatte?

9941
Andrew Bainbridge

Ich führe kontinuierlich Serious Samurize aus, um Diagramme der CPU-, Festplatten- und Netzwerknutzung anzuzeigen. Gelegentlich sehe ich, dass mein E: -Laufwerk (eine Festplatte ohne Systemdateien, nur Daten) wegfällt, wenn dies nicht der Fall sein sollte (etwa 50% Bandbreitenauslastung in der Grafik). Mit dem Process Explorer sehe ich, dass der Schuldige CcmExec ist, eine Standard-Windows-Komponente. Es sieht so aus, als würde jede Datei auf der Festplatte gelesen.

Also, meine Frage, warum tut CcmExec mir das an? Und wie höre ich damit auf? Das Anhalten von CcmExec vom Process Explorer funktioniert gut, aber ich muss daran denken, dies jedes Mal zu tun, wenn ich meine Maschine starte. Ich vermute, es gibt einen besseren Weg, um es mit den schmutzigen Fingern meines E-Laufwerks zu sagen.

Ich verwende Windows XP in einem Firmennetzwerk.

6
Die Deaktivierung von "SMS Agent" in den Windows-Diensten schien den Trick zu erfüllen. Andrew Bainbridge vor 12 Jahren 0

2 Antworten auf die Frage

5
Christothes

In einigen Fällen kann dies auf eine Beschädigung von WMI zurückzuführen sein. Bei der Untersuchung der Threads, die die CPU-Auslastung in Process Explorer verursachen, finden Sie möglicherweise WMI irgendwo im Stack.

Führen Sie den folgenden Befehl an einer Eingabeaufforderung mit erhöhten Rechten aus.

winmgmt /resetrepository 

Möglicherweise erhalten Sie folgende Fehlermeldung:

  • WMI-Repository-Reset fehlgeschlagen
  • Fehlercode: 0x8007041B
  • Einrichtung: Win32
  • Beschreibung: Die Stoppsteuerung wurde an einen Dienst gesendet, von dem andere ausgeführte Dienste abhängig sind.

Wenn ja, versuchen Sie den winmgmtBefehl erneut auszuführen, nachdem Sie den ccmexec.exeVorgang beendet haben.

WmiPrvSE hat 350 MB RAM auf meinem System verbraucht. Die Protokolle haben ccmexec gefingert. Stop-Reset-Start und jetzt sieht es besser aus. John Fouhy vor 12 Jahren 0
Dies scheint einer Lösung näher zu sein. Dadurch und durch einen Neustart konnte ccmexec.exe nicht endlos auf der Festplatte gesucht werden. Nach dem Neustart sehe ich immer noch WmiPrvSE und svchost.exe, die eine Festplattenwarteschlange verursachen und CPU verwenden. Nach ein paar Minuten ist alles auf 0 gefallen. Ich werde posten, wenn ich mehr herausfinde ... Wouter vor 10 Jahren 0
2
heavyd

CcmExec ist Teil des Systems Management Server von Microsoft. Es gibt einige Artikel in MSDN-Blogs, die sich mit diesem Problem befassen. Sie sollten dies verhindern können, indem Sie den Dienst "SMS Agent Host" beenden.

Jonathan Hardwick bietet drei Möglichkeiten, den Dienst zu deaktivieren:

  • Von der Befehlszeile aus: sc stop ccmexec und sc start ccmexec(wobei sc c: \ windows \ system32 \ sc.exe ist)
  • Von der GUI 1: Öffnen Sie die Serviceliste, klicken Sie mit der rechten Maustaste auf den SMS Agent Host-Dienst, und wählen Sie Stopp oder Start.
  • Von der GUI # 2: getippt hat sc stop ccmexecund sc start ccmexecin Start> Ausführen, verwenden Sie das Dropdown-Menü Geschichte am Ende der Run - Box sie erneut ausführen, wann immer Sie wollen.
Dies ist eher eine Problemumgehung als eine Lösung. Christothes vor 12 Jahren 1
Dies ist -nicht- eine Lösung. Dadurch werden Updates deaktiviert. Es ist bestenfalls eine vorübergehende Problemumgehung. Deaktivieren Sie die Markierung als Antwort, damit die Community dies näher betrachten kann. Wouter vor 10 Jahren 0
Christothes 'Antwort hat das Problem behoben ... ganz oder teilweise. Noch nicht sicher... Wouter vor 10 Jahren 0